I’ve always believed that novels have the power to inspire, and when they’re available as PDFs, they become even more accessible. One of my absolute favorites is 'The Alchemist' by Paulo Coelho. This book is a journey of self-discovery, following Santiago, a shepherd boy who dreams of finding a worldly treasure. The story is simple yet profound, weaving themes of destiny, perseverance, and the importance of listening to one’s heart. The PDF version is widely available, making it easy to revisit its wisdom anytime. The narrative’s poetic style and universal lessons make it a timeless read, whether you’re looking for motivation or a reminder to chase your dreams. Another inspiring novel is 'Man’s Search for Meaning' by Viktor E. Frankl. While not fiction, it reads like a novel, detailing Frankl’s experiences in Nazi concentration camps and his development of logotherapy. The PDF format is perfect for highlighting passages that resonate deeply, such as his insights on finding purpose in suffering. The book’s message—that life has meaning even in the bleakest circumstances—is incredibly uplifting. It’s a stark yet hopeful reminder of human resilience, and the PDF allows you to carry its lessons wherever you go. For those who enjoy historical fiction, 'The Book Thief' by Markus Zusak is a must-read. The novel, narrated by Death, follows Liesel Meminger, a young girl in Nazi Germany who finds solace in stealing books. The PDF version captures the haunting beauty of Zusak’s prose, with phrases that linger long after reading. The story’s exploration of kindness amid brutality is deeply moving, and its unconventional narrative style makes it stand out. It’s a book that inspires not just through its plot but through its sheer artistry, and having it as a PDF means you can revisit its most poignant moments anytime. If you’re drawn to stories of personal triumph, 'Educated' by Tara Westover is a gripping memoir that reads like a novel. The PDF version is widely shared, making it easy to access her incredible journey from a survivalist family in Idaho to earning a PhD from Cambridge. Her story is a testament to the transformative power of education and self-belief. The raw honesty of her writing makes it impossible to look away, and the PDF format lets you absorb her words at your own pace. It’s a book that challenges you to rethink the limits of your own potential.
